In 2018, 30 Point Strategies implemented CrownPeak DXP for Web Content Management on its public website. The deployment centered on using CrownPeak Web Content Management to deliver content authoring, templating, digital asset management, and publishing workflows that support the firm’s marketing and client facing content. Functional configuration emphasized page templates, editorial workflows, version control, and role based approvals to streamline content updates.
Operational scope was confined to the corporate website and the marketing function, reflecting the ten person professional services structure and modest content footprint. Integrations are limited to the website channel as noted in the source, with the CrownPeak DXP implementation acting as the central content repository and orchestration layer for site publishing. Governance and process changes focused on establishing editorial ownership, approval gates, and structured content templates to maintain consistency across service descriptions and case studies.

In 2020, 30 Point Strategies implemented BoomTown CRM and is using the application on their public website to capture inbound real estate leads. BoomTown CRM is deployed as a cloud hosted Real Estate CRM and was configured to centralize lead capture, contact management, pipeline tracking and reporting aligned to the firm’s client acquisition workflows.
Deployment and operational scope focused on sales and marketing functions for the 10 person professional services firm, with website integration routing leads directly into the BoomTown CRM contact database and enabling assignment and follow up workflows. Configuration emphasized online lead forms, contact enrichment, opportunity staging and task orchestration, and governance centered on standardized lead intake, assignment rules and CRM usage policies during rollout.
